How do you succeed in writing cozy mysteries? Ella Barnard welcomes Cheryl Phipps, a USA Today best-selling romance author. Cheryl advises how you want more people to look guilty or have the potential to be the criminal. Then there should be love and trust, usually the sheriff, deputy, or forensic person. But writing the story is just the first step; there’s still the publishing and marketing to work on. If you believe in yourself, jump in with your boots and all. The more stories you put out there, the better you become. Join the conversation for more real-life writing wisdom!
